Transaction 3307f7621dd29802995a898a7eea900f81abc717d48d927a72f5949d041e2a47

1 Input
2 Outputs
  • 3307f7621dd29802995a898a7eea900f81abc717d48d927a72f5949d041e2a47:0
  • value  14916
    address  1FhLHxCitxEXXf7S4KtydG5VUuSW9HXJQ8
  • 3307f7621dd29802995a898a7eea900f81abc717d48d927a72f5949d041e2a47:1
  • value  884817
    address  17xnSz3j34JJRAx5aLoG6nas4E9ucmhm7t